Output 7bdbeac3c2c25d60945f5fcb6ef8d10875e15da9fb1fa9ea23d0211794fd3907:1

value
1797315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8721c58b9a933f19a3485fe4219cd4d507853d1c OP_EQUAL
address
3E1XbwJSCTu62wn352wNagS2HkLoPRqLPG
transaction
7bdbeac3c2c25d60945f5fcb6ef8d10875e15da9fb1fa9ea23d0211794fd3907
confirmations
305079
spent
true